Head to head by decade
| Decade | Grenada | Israel |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 322.33 Cases | 1,130 Cases | 807.83 Cases | Israel |
| 1980s | 209.3 Cases | 1,419 Cases | 1,210 Cases | Israel |
| 1990s | 1.1 Cases | 305.8 Cases | 304.7 Cases | Israel |
| 2000s | 0 Cases | 178.3 Cases | 178.3 Cases | Israel |
| 2010s | 0 Cases | 480.6 Cases | 480.6 Cases | Israel |
| 2020s | 0 Cases | 3 Cases | 3 Cases | Israel |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
